Effects of Questions and Test-Like Events on Achievement and On-Task Behavior in a Classroom Concept Learning Presentation.
McKenzie, Gary R.
Journal of Educational Research, v72 n6 p348-51 Jul-Aug 1979
Having all students in a group respond to every question, rather than addressing questions to one student at a time, resulted in better behavior and content achievement among third graders. (Editor)
